The Sound of Charleston

Come enjoy the music of Charleston’s rich history, from gospel spirituals to jazz, music of George Gershwin to Civil War campsongs, and light classics of the St. Cecelia Society. Live concerts are presented weekly at historic Circular Congregational Church. Hear “Amazing Grace” sung in the church where composer John Newton worshipped and received inspiration.
